Commit 4052cb4372af571dea7a1be75fc4d90e00a3112c
1 parent
0f985f01
20.07.16
Showing
2 changed files
with
2 additions
and
1 deletions
Show diff stats
common/modules/product/models/Product.php
... | ... | @@ -333,7 +333,7 @@ class Product extends \yii\db\ActiveRecord |
333 | 333 | ProductCategory::deleteAll(['product_id' => $this->product_id]); |
334 | 334 | ProductVariant::deleteAll(['product_id' => $this->product_id]); |
335 | 335 | ProductOption::deleteAll(['product_id' => $this->product_id]); |
336 | - ProductVariantOption::deleteAll(['product_id' => $this->product_id]); | |
336 | + //ProductVariantOption::deleteAll(['product_id' => $this->product_id]); | |
337 | 337 | ProductStock::deleteAll(['product_id' => $this->product_id]); |
338 | 338 | Share::deleteAll(['product_id' => $this->product_id]); |
339 | 339 | return true; | ... | ... |
common/modules/product/models/ProductVariant.php
... | ... | @@ -274,6 +274,7 @@ class ProductVariant extends \yii\db\ActiveRecord |
274 | 274 | // } |
275 | 275 | |
276 | 276 | public function beforeDelete() { |
277 | + ProductVariantOption::deleteAll(['product_variant_id' => $this->product_variant_id]); | |
277 | 278 | ProductImage::deleteAll(['product_variant_id' => $this->product_variant_id]); |
278 | 279 | ProductStock::deleteAll(['product_variant_id' => $this->product_variant_id]); |
279 | 280 | return true; | ... | ... |